When tournaments don't go my way

Analyze what went differently than I hoped and consider what I should have done, or at least tried.   I've learned far more about fishing from my bad days than I have from my good days.


Advice to give to an aspiring tournament angler:

Enter the co-angler division in as many draw tournaments as you can afford to and have time for, including traveling away from your home lake.  This includes everything from local clubs to regional tours to national pro tours.   Pay attention to EVERYTHING.  You'll experience many styles of fishing, many brands of boats and equipment, many personalities, time management, etc., etc. and will quickly find which of these things best suits YOU.  You'll learn a ton from watching youtube and reading magazines, but nothing beats time on the water.  Draw tournaments expose you to the most diversity in the shortest amount of time.
